With a view to drawing up digitised maps of liquefaction risk along the Romagna coast, for which about eight hundred cone penetration tests (CPT) are available, four different methods based on CPT to evaluate safety factor profiles are analysed and compared. The methods considered are those proposed by (1) Robertson and Wride (1997), (2) Suzuki et a!. (1997), (3) Shibata and Teparaska (1988), and (4) Olsen (1997). The synthetic index introduced by Iwasaki et al. (1978), representative of the liquefaction potential in corre¬spondence with every profile explored by means of CPT, was employed for drawing up the digitised liquefac¬tion risk maps. Up until now, one hundred mechanical cone penetration tests have been digitised. The afore¬said four methods have been applied to these tests. A comparison of these methods points out a substantial agreement between the results.
